生成船期管理后端代码

This commit is contained in:
2026-03-03 17:45:03 +08:00
parent d81b94031b
commit eff1760244
20 changed files with 342 additions and 147 deletions

View File

@ -1,22 +1,16 @@
package com.xjrsoft.module.ship.dto;
import java.io.Serializable;
import java.math.BigDecimal;
import java.util.List;
import com.pictc.annotations.datalog.LogAttrField;
import com.pictc.annotations.datalog.LogField;
import com.pictc.annotations.datalog.LogTable;
import com.xjrsoft.module.system.dto.UpdateLngFileUploadDto;
import io.swagger.annotations.ApiModelProperty;
import lombok.Data;
import java.io.Serializable;
import java.time.LocalTime;
import java.time.LocalDateTime;
import java.math.BigDecimal;
import com.fasterxml.jackson.annotation.JsonFormat;
import java.util.List;
import com.pictc.annotations.datalog.LogTable;
import com.pictc.annotations.datalog.LogField;
import com.pictc.annotations.datalog.LogJoin;
import com.pictc.annotations.datalog.LogJoinColumn;
import com.pictc.annotations.datalog.JoinCaseType;
import com.pictc.annotations.datalog.JoinType;
import com.pictc.annotations.datalog.ValueDirectionType;
@ -50,7 +44,7 @@ public class UpdateLngMeaPurIntDto implements Serializable {
/**
* 计量类型(L-装载计量/U-卸载计量)
*/
@LogField(name="计量类型(L-装载计量/U-卸载计量)",index=2)
@LogField(name="计量类型",index=2)
@ApiModelProperty("计量类型(L-装载计量/U-卸载计量)")
private String typeCode;
@ -64,63 +58,63 @@ public class UpdateLngMeaPurIntDto implements Serializable {
/**
* 热值MMBtu
*/
@LogField(name="热值MMBtu",index=4)
@LogField(name="热值",index=4)
@ApiModelProperty("热值MMBtu")
private BigDecimal qtyMmbtu;
/**
* 热值GJ
*/
@LogField(name="热值GJ",index=5)
@LogField(name="热值",index=5)
@ApiModelProperty("热值GJ")
private BigDecimal qtyGj;
/**
* 重量(吨)
*/
@LogField(name="重量(吨)",index=6)
@LogField(name="重量",index=6)
@ApiModelProperty("重量(吨)")
private BigDecimal qtyTon;
/**
* 液态体积(方)
*/
@LogField(name="液态体积(方)",index=7)
@LogField(name="液态体积",index=7)
@ApiModelProperty("液态体积(方)")
private BigDecimal qtyM3L;
/**
* 气态体积(方)
*/
@LogField(name="气态体积(方)",index=8)
@LogField(name="气态体积",index=8)
@ApiModelProperty("气态体积(方)")
private BigDecimal qtyM3;
/**
* 密度(吨/液态方)
*/
@LogField(name="密度(吨/液态方)",index=9)
@LogField(name="密度",index=9)
@ApiModelProperty("密度(吨/液态方)")
private BigDecimal rateTonM3L;
/**
* 热值比(吨/GJ)
*/
@LogField(name="热值比(吨/GJ)",index=10)
@LogField(name="热值比",index=10)
@ApiModelProperty("热值比(吨/GJ)")
private BigDecimal rateTonGj;
/**
* 热值比(气态方/GJ)
*/
@LogField(name="热值比(气态方/GJ)",index=11)
@LogField(name="热值比",index=11)
@ApiModelProperty("热值比(气态方/GJ)")
private BigDecimal rateM3Gj;
/**
* 气化率(吨/气态方)
*/
@LogField(name="气化率(吨/气态方)",index=12)
@LogField(name="气化率",index=12)
@ApiModelProperty("气化率(吨/气态方)")
private BigDecimal rateTonM3;
@ -134,7 +128,7 @@ public class UpdateLngMeaPurIntDto implements Serializable {
/**
* 来源(接收站发送数据表主键;非空时记录不可修改删除)
*/
@LogField(name="来源(接收站发送数据表主键;非空时记录不可修改删除)",index=14)
@LogField(name="来源",index=14)
@ApiModelProperty("来源(接收站发送数据表主键;非空时记录不可修改删除)")
private String dataSource;
@ -152,5 +146,11 @@ public class UpdateLngMeaPurIntDto implements Serializable {
@ApiModelProperty("租户id")
private Long tenantId;
/**
* lngFileUpload
*/
@ApiModelProperty("lngFileUpload子表")
@LogAttrField
private List<UpdateLngFileUploadDto> fileList;
}

View File

@ -1,22 +1,17 @@
package com.xjrsoft.module.ship.dto;
import java.io.Serializable;
import java.math.BigDecimal;
import java.time.LocalDateTime;
import java.util.List;
import com.pictc.annotations.datalog.LogAttrField;
import com.pictc.annotations.datalog.LogField;
import com.pictc.annotations.datalog.LogTable;
import com.xjrsoft.module.system.dto.UpdateLngFileUploadDto;
import io.swagger.annotations.ApiModelProperty;
import lombok.Data;
import java.io.Serializable;
import java.time.LocalTime;
import java.time.LocalDateTime;
import java.math.BigDecimal;
import com.fasterxml.jackson.annotation.JsonFormat;
import java.util.List;
import com.pictc.annotations.datalog.LogTable;
import com.pictc.annotations.datalog.LogField;
import com.pictc.annotations.datalog.LogJoin;
import com.pictc.annotations.datalog.LogJoinColumn;
import com.pictc.annotations.datalog.JoinCaseType;
import com.pictc.annotations.datalog.JoinType;
import com.pictc.annotations.datalog.ValueDirectionType;
@ -509,5 +504,10 @@ public class UpdateLngOpsPurIntDto implements Serializable {
@ApiModelProperty("租户id")
private Long tenantId;
/**
* lngFileUpload
*/
@ApiModelProperty("lngFileUpload子表")
@LogAttrField
private List<UpdateLngFileUploadDto> fileList;
}

View File

@ -1,22 +1,17 @@
package com.xjrsoft.module.ship.dto;
import java.io.Serializable;
import java.math.BigDecimal;
import java.time.LocalDateTime;
import java.util.List;
import com.pictc.annotations.datalog.LogAttrField;
import com.pictc.annotations.datalog.LogField;
import com.pictc.annotations.datalog.LogTable;
import com.xjrsoft.module.system.dto.UpdateLngFileUploadDto;
import io.swagger.annotations.ApiModelProperty;
import lombok.Data;
import java.io.Serializable;
import java.time.LocalTime;
import java.time.LocalDateTime;
import java.math.BigDecimal;
import com.fasterxml.jackson.annotation.JsonFormat;
import java.util.List;
import com.pictc.annotations.datalog.LogTable;
import com.pictc.annotations.datalog.LogField;
import com.pictc.annotations.datalog.LogJoin;
import com.pictc.annotations.datalog.LogJoinColumn;
import com.pictc.annotations.datalog.JoinCaseType;
import com.pictc.annotations.datalog.JoinType;
import com.pictc.annotations.datalog.ValueDirectionType;
@ -481,5 +476,11 @@ public class UpdateLngOpsSalesIntDto implements Serializable {
@ApiModelProperty("租户id")
private Long tenantId;
/**
* lngFileUpload
*/
@ApiModelProperty("lngFileUpload子表")
@LogAttrField
private List<UpdateLngFileUploadDto> fileList;
}

View File

@ -16,7 +16,9 @@ import com.pictc.annotations.datalog.LogJoin;
import com.pictc.annotations.datalog.LogJoinColumn;
import com.pictc.annotations.datalog.JoinCaseType;
import com.pictc.annotations.datalog.JoinType;
import com.pictc.annotations.datalog.LogAttrField;
import com.pictc.annotations.datalog.ValueDirectionType;
import com.xjrsoft.module.system.dto.UpdateLngFileUploadDto;
@ -327,5 +329,12 @@ public class UpdateLngShipScheduleDto implements Serializable {
@ApiModelProperty("租户id")
private Long tenantId;
/**
* lngFileUpload
*/
@ApiModelProperty("lngFileUpload子表")
@LogAttrField
private List<UpdateLngFileUploadDto> fileList;
}

View File

@ -13,6 +13,7 @@ import java.math.BigDecimal;
import java.util.List;
import com.xjrsoft.module.ship.dto.AddLngMeaPurIntDto;
import com.xjrsoft.module.system.vo.LngFileUploadVo;
/**
* @title: 表单出参
@ -183,7 +184,7 @@ public class LngMeaPurIntVo extends com.xjrsoft.common.model.base.BaseModel{
@ApiModelProperty("数据权限id")
private Long ruleUserId;
List<LngFileUploadVo> fileList ;

View File

@ -13,6 +13,7 @@ import java.math.BigDecimal;
import java.util.List;
import com.xjrsoft.module.ship.dto.AddLngMeaPurIntDto;
import com.xjrsoft.module.system.vo.LngFileUploadVo;
/**
* @title: 表单出参
@ -541,7 +542,7 @@ public class LngOpsPurIntVo extends com.xjrsoft.common.model.base.BaseModel{
private Long ruleUserId;
List<LngFileUploadVo> fileList;
}

View File

@ -2,6 +2,9 @@ package com.xjrsoft.module.ship.vo;
import java.math.BigDecimal;
import java.time.LocalDateTime;
import java.util.List;
import com.xjrsoft.module.system.vo.LngFileUploadVo;
import io.swagger.annotations.ApiModelProperty;
import lombok.Data;
@ -505,7 +508,7 @@ public class LngOpsSalesIntVo extends com.xjrsoft.common.model.base.BaseModel{
private Long ruleUserId;
List<LngFileUploadVo> fileList;
}

View File

@ -1,16 +1,13 @@
package com.xjrsoft.module.ship.vo;
import java.math.BigDecimal;
import java.time.LocalDateTime;
import java.util.List;
import com.xjrsoft.module.system.vo.LngFileUploadVo;
import io.swagger.annotations.ApiModelProperty;
import lombok.Data;
import lombok.Getter;
import lombok.Setter;
import lombok.ToString;
import lombok.experimental.Accessors;
import java.time.LocalTime;
import java.time.LocalDateTime;
import java.math.BigDecimal;
import java.util.List;
/**
* @title: 表单出参
@ -357,7 +354,7 @@ public class LngShipScheduleVo extends com.xjrsoft.common.model.base.BaseModel{
private Long ruleUserId;
private List<LngFileUploadVo> fileList;
}